Transaction 873ecfc58bfff314820bece9c996dc9e9953e627a94b93bd1902fe149e676ae3
1 Input
2 Outputs
- 873ecfc58bfff314820bece9c996dc9e9953e627a94b93bd1902fe149e676ae3:0
- 873ecfc58bfff314820bece9c996dc9e9953e627a94b93bd1902fe149e676ae3:1
value 77352
address 15eFYv82Fcx55sw3wZFqTifg75oGHsbSXK
value 15071059
address 3EBRAfD1RSmVrGobv22Pn2Z7ukb6TEtqDy